Hall Anchor is one of the earliest stockless anchors adopted for commercial shipping and remains widely used on cargo vessels, tankers, fishing boats, workboats, dredgers, and offshore support vessels. The anchor consists of a cast steel shank, anchor crown, and two movable flukes connected through a pivot arrangement. During anchoring, the flukes rotate to penetrate the seabed and develop holding force, while the stockless design allows the anchor to be housed completely inside the ship's hawse pipe.
Hall Anchors are manufactured from marine-grade cast steel using casting, heat treatment, machining, dimensional inspection, and proof testing processes. Standard products are available from 25 kg to 30,000 kg, covering applications from small working vessels to large commercial ships. The anchor is suitable for operation in sand, clay, mud, gravel, and mixed seabed conditions and is commonly used with stud link or studless anchor chains as part of complete anchoring systems.
Compared with stocked anchors, the stockless Hall Anchor occupies less storage space, simplifies anchor handling, and is compatible with modern bow anchoring arrangements. It remains one of the most commonly specified stockless anchors for merchant vessels built in accordance with international classification society rules.

Manufacturing Standards: Manufactured in accordance with the applicable requirements of IACS Unified Requirement A1, IACS Unified Requirement W18, ISO 1704, and recognized marine anchor manufacturing specifications. Products are available with certification from ABS, BV, CCS, DNV, LR, NK, KR, RINA, and RS according to customer requirements.
Testing Standards: Each anchor undergoes chemical composition verification, casting inspection, dimensional inspection, heat treatment verification, mechanical property testing, proof load testing, visual inspection, non-destructive examination (where applicable), and permanent identification marking verification before shipment. Material certificates, inspection reports, classification society certificates (when required), and complete traceability documentation are supplied with every order.
Application Standards: Suitable for bulk carriers, container ships, general cargo vessels, oil tankers, chemical tankers, fishing vessels, tugboats, dredgers, offshore support vessels, barges, port service vessels, and other commercial marine applications using stockless anchor systems.
Maintenance Standards: Inspect the anchor regularly for fluke wear, shank deformation, pivot pin wear, casting defects, corrosion, coating damage, and identification markings. Check that the flukes rotate freely without excessive clearance. Inspection, repair, and replacement should comply with the vessel maintenance program and the requirements of the applicable classification society to maintain anchoring system reliability.
